What is Toremifene Citrate?
Toremifene citrate is a selective estrogen receptor modulator (SERM) that is primarily used in the treatment of breast cancer. It works by binding to estrogen receptors in the body, blocking the effects of estrogen. This can be beneficial in breast cancer treatment as many breast cancers are estrogen-sensitive.
